Brookside Bar & Grill navigating amended liquor license by council
After a vote by Marine City Council to amend a liquor license changing where they can serve alcohol on their property, Brookside Bar & Grill is navigating their future business operations. A packed house filled the July 11 city council meeting to hear the council’s decision regarding the restaurant where many locals and visitors to the community frequently visit.

Burtson, Terrence "Terry" Age 78, of Isanti, passed away on Tuesday, July 16, 2024. Born on September 9, 1945, in Minneapolis, Terry was the beloved son of Arthur and Helen (Erickson) Burtson. Raised in Fridley, he graduated from Fridley High School in 1963 before pursuing a degree in accounting at Winona State University and the University of Minnesota. Terry is survived by his devoted wife, Lorelei; his daughters, Shelly (Charles) Kinnunen and Gretchen (Tony) Walz; grandchildren, Kale and Courtney Kinnunen, and Meghan and Andrew Walz. A memorial service to celebrate Terry's life will be held at 11:00 AM on Wednesday, July 24, 2024, at OUR SAVIOUR'S LUTHERAN CHURCH (19001 Jackson St NE, East Bethel, MN 55011) with visitation one hour prior to the service. kozlakradulovich.com "A Celebration of Life" 763-783-1100.
Donna Brundage
Brundage, Donna 82, of White Bear Lake, passed away unexpectedly on July 11, 2024. She was preceded in death by her husband of 61 years, James; parents, Francis and Donald Kuecker. She is survived by siblings, Jo Ann (Mathews), Donald (Darlene) Kuecker Jr., Richard (Margie) Kuecker, Mary Ala, Larry (Karen) Kuecker, Betty (Mike) Pauley, Robert (Roberta) Kuecker, and Barry (Chris) Kuecker; and many other nieces, nephews, family and friends. Donna was born in IA on a farm and grew up in MN. She was a telephone operator for 32 years, after retirement she and Jim enjoyed traveling, visiting casinos and garage sales. She was a great sister and aunt to many; she will be greatly missed by all. A celebration of life will be held at 1:30 PM on Saturday, July 27, 2024 at the American Legion, 2210 3rd St., White Bear Lake, MN 55110. Interment of James and Donna will take place on Monday, September, 16, 2024 at 11:15 AM at Fort Snelling National Cemetery, meeting at Assembly area #2. Unmanned aerials -- drones -- coming to Lakes Area P.D.
Unmanned aerial vehicles—more commonly known as drones, are soon becoming part of the arsenal of investigative equipment used by Lakes Area Police. Minnesota state laws require unmanned aerial vehicles not be activated until the department has adopted a policy, and last week the four-member Police Commission reviewed the program and supported continuing to pursue drones. Developing the policy is just a ‘first step’ the commission members heard, and actual purchase and deployment of any drones could be another year yet.
